The FlashSoft team at SanDisk Enterprise Storage Solutions is seeking a Sr. Staff Software Engineer for its Milpitas, CA Corporate office. In this position, the individual will need at least 5 years in Windows kernel driver development. Storage stack, cluster (MSCS), virtualization (Hyper-V, CSV) and NTFS understanding is plus. Performance understanding and caching understanding are must. Network understanding is a plus.

This position requires a BS/BA degree or equivalent with 9 or more years of related experience. The ideal individual must have proven ability to achieve results in a fast moving, dynamic environment. Self-motivated and self-directed, however, must have demonstrated ability to work well with people. A proven desire to work as a team member, both on the same team and outside of the team. Ability to work effectively cross-functionally. Ability to troubleshoot and analyze complex problems. Ability to multi-task and meet deadlines. Excellent communication (written and verbal) and interpersonal skills.

SanDisk offers a highly competitive compensation package and great benefits, which include Stock Options, ESPP, matched 401(k), comprehensive insurance and tuition reimbursement.
